Our Private Business team specialise in providing corporate tax advice to privately owned and Private Equity backed businesses together with owners and management teams on all aspects of tax in the UK and abroad including shareholder issues.
Our curious minds and collaborative spirit enables us to work together, helping clients navigate the ever changing tax landscape. As part of the team you’ll be actively encouraged to consult, to share specialist knowledge and new ideas as we continue to innovate to deliver best in class service.
A key role in a growing team, working closely with experienced Private Business Partners and Directors to develop new client relationships (including many well-known household names), identifying, and pursuing new opportunities from within our market.
What Your Days Will Look Like
- Ownership for a diverse and broad portfolio of client engagements, including privately owned and private equity portfolio companies advising on tax technical issues.
- Developing significant market relationships with clients and internal stakeholders.
- Collaborating across the firm when delivering complex projects / events.
- Maintaining an expert level of relevant tax knowledge (both UK and overseas) including changes in tax law and legislation.
The successful candidate will possess initiative, drive, and the proven ability to work with and help lead a growing team, possessing the personal skills to maintain deep, trusted long-term relationships with our clients and contacts in the market.
Must possess:
- ACA and/or CTA qualification (or international equivalent).
- Relevant and up-to-date UK (and some overseas) tax knowledge.
- Varied experience of more complex tax issues facing privately or family-owned businesses, private equity portfolio companies and business owners.
- Project management skills - able to manage several client projects simultaneously.
- Stakeholder management and coaching ethos.
- Excellent written communication - including reports, technical memos.
